Chapter 18: Problem 10
What is a certify lock? What are the advantages and disadvantages of using certify locks?
Short Answer
Step by step solution
Key Concepts
These are the key concepts you need to understand to accurately answer the question.
/*! This file is auto-generated */ .wp-block-button__link{color:#fff;background-color:#32373c;border-radius:9999px;box-shadow:none;text-decoration:none;padding:calc(.667em + 2px) calc(1.333em + 2px);font-size:1.125em}.wp-block-file__button{background:#32373c;color:#fff;text-decoration:none}
Learning Materials
Features
Discover
Chapter 18: Problem 10
What is a certify lock? What are the advantages and disadvantages of using certify locks?
These are the key concepts you need to understand to accurately answer the question.
All the tools & learning materials you need for study success - in one app.
Get started for free
Prove that the wait-die and wound-wait protocols avoid deadlock and starvation.
What is a timestamp? How does the system generate timestamps?
How do optimistic concurrency control techniques differ from other concurrency control techniques? Why are they also called validation or certification tech. niques? Discuss the typical phases of an optimistic concurrency control method.
What is a phantom record? Discuss the problem that a phantom record can cause for concurrency control.
Prove that strict two-phase locking guarantees strict schedules.
What do you think about this solution?
We value your feedback to improve our textbook solutions.